"I will try hard not to disappoint the people of South Africa"- President Cyril Ramaphosa, recently sworn-in as South-Africa's new president. Photo: Google.
He promised to tackle corruption the real plague that prompted the recall of former President Jacob Zuma, While many hailed this new development as a new model for democracy in Africa, the country's opposition party; the Economic Freedom Fighters says the swearing in of Mr Ramaphosa as the new President of South-Africa is illegitimate, and calls for new elections. The party says he's "Illegitimate President" and this action could further compound democracy and it's crisis in Africa.
